1960 Ferreira vintage port

Post by Alex Bridgeman »

Opened as part of the Wokingham offline on 11 June 2009.

Ullaged to mid-shoulder. Very pale orange rim; crystal clear and the colour of burnt sugar. Again, some bottle stink but caramelised comes through strongly. Sweet redcurrant dominates the mouth with a lovely balancing acidity. Quite big and mouthfilling. Lemony aftertaste followed by a sweet and lingering aftertaste. Very good indeed. 91/100.
